Why do people hunt with spears?

Why do people hunt with spears?

When modern hunter-gatherers use their spears as thrusting, rather than thrown, weapons, it’s usually because they’ve chosen to ambush their prey or drive it into swamps or bodies of water.

When did humans invent spears?

Neanderthals were constructing stone spear heads from as early as 300,000 BP, and by 250,000 years ago, wooden spears were made with fire-hardened points. From circa 200,000 BCE onwards, Middle Paleolithic humans began to make complex stone blades with flaked edges which were used as spear heads.

Can you hunt hogs with spears?

Pigsticking is a form of boar hunting done by individuals, or groups of spearmen on foot or on horseback using a specialized boar spear. The boar spear was sometimes fitted with a cross guard to stop the enraged animal driving its pierced body further down the shaft in order to attack its killer before dying.
